What is CMAA?
The Construction Management Association of America (CMAA) is a leading organization in the construction management industry. It focuses on promoting the profession of construction management and improving its practice. CMAA offers certification programs, educational opportunities, and resources that are vital for anyone involved in construction management, including home inspectors.
Key Offerings of CMAA
- Certification Programs: CMAA offers the Certified Construction Manager (CCM) designation, which is a mark of professional achievement in the construction management field. While this certification is more directly relevant to construction managers, understanding the standards and practices it represents can be beneficial for home inspectors.
- Educational Resources: The organization provides a wealth of educational materials, including guides, standards, and best practices in construction management. These resources can help home inspectors stay updated with the latest trends and standards in the construction industry.
- Conferences and Workshops: CMAA hosts various events that can be great learning and networking opportunities for home inspectors. These events often cover a range of topics relevant to construction management and inspection.
